Bonjour
Je souhaiterai changer le nom d'un plugin.
Je respecte bien sur le fait que le nom du dossier doit être similaire au fichier principal plsPlugin --> plsPlugin.php
Mais y-a-t-il beaucoup d'autres endroits à modifier?
En raccourcis, il faut scanner les fichiers du plugin et remplacer manuellement toutes les chaines de l'ancien nom par la nouvelle.
Si tu veut garder le fichier de configuration, il y a aussi le fichier monPlugin.xml dans data/configuration/plugins/
Pense à désactiver le plugin avant modifications , sinon à le retirer de la liste des plugins dans data/configuration/plugins.xml
Ce n'est pas exhaustif, mais il n'y qu'aux endroits ou le nom du plugin est indiqué en clair qu'il faut voir à modifier
cdt
Cordialement, gcyrillus , simple membre du forum et utilisateur de pluxml
Merci
C'est déjà un bon début.
je voulais reprendre mon projet de boutique en utilisant un fork du plugin myPlxShop.
Mais je vais d'abord finaliser mon theme de base
Cordialement
Réponses
Bonjour @cpalo, à priori il y a plus de modifications à faire, cf. https://wiki.pluxml.org/docs/develop/plugins/index.html
Bonjour,
Le nom de dossier est utiliser pour
Ensuite les autres endroits où tu peut retrouver le nom du plugin sont
Il y a plusieurs façon de récupérer ou d'indiquer le nom du plugin :
par exemple pour indiquer un chemin vers un fichier du plugin :
'monPlugin'
$this->plg['name']
basename(__DIR__)
__CLASS__
qui donne , pour charger un script par exemple , ces options d’écriture :
Pour charger la class d'un plugin et en faire usage à partir d'une autre fonction ou d'un autre plugin .
En raccourcis, il faut scanner les fichiers du plugin et remplacer manuellement toutes les chaines de l'ancien nom par la nouvelle.
Si tu veut garder le fichier de configuration, il y a aussi le fichier
monPlugin.xml
dansdata/configuration/plugins/
Pense à désactiver le plugin avant modifications , sinon à le retirer de la liste des plugins dans
data/configuration/plugins.xml
Ce n'est pas exhaustif, mais il n'y qu'aux endroits ou le nom du plugin est indiqué en clair qu'il faut voir à modifier
cdt
Cordialement,
gcyrillus , simple membre du forum et utilisateur de pluxml
Mon site PluXml: https://re7net.com | Plugins: https://ressources.pluxopolis.net/banque-plugins/index.php?all_versions | demos sur free http://gcyrillus.free.fr/new | Thèmes: tester et télécharger @ https://pluxthemes.com
Indiquez [RESOLU] dans le titre de votre question une fois le soucis réglè, Merci
Merci
C'est déjà un bon début.
je voulais reprendre mon projet de boutique en utilisant un fork du plugin myPlxShop.
Mais je vais d'abord finaliser mon theme de base
Cordialement